hen contacted by an owner wishing to rehome their pet we obtain as much information as possible to ascertain why there may be an issue. We ask the owner to have their pet vet checked and make sure it is microchipped. Initially the owner may only need advice concerning their pets behaviour so one of our behaviourists gets in touch. If the pet is still to be rehomed then a volunteer caseworker is allocated who contacts the owner to obtain further information on the pet sufficient to enable us to match the people offering to foster or adopt a pet. We arrange transport to the foster or adopter and meet all related expenses until a pet is adopted. In some circumstances we meet ongoing medical expenses even when a pet has been adopted.

Objectives: 2. The association’s objects are: a) To assist owners of Sprocker Spaniels who are experiencing difficulties with the intention of enabling the Sprocker to stay with the owner. b) To foster/rehome Sprocker Spaniels when the owners can no longer manage their dog for whatever reason.
